PlagiarismCheck.org
PlagiarismCheck.org is a sophisticated online platform that combines plagiarism detection with AI content identification capabilities. The service employs advanced algorithms to analyze texts for similarities, detect AI-generated content, and identify various forms of potential plagiarism, including word substitutions and sentence rearrangements.
With over 8 years of experience and serving more than 1 million users, the platform integrates seamlessly with major educational tools like Moodle, Google Classroom, and Canvas. The system offers detailed reports with source attribution, interactive results, and maintains strict confidentiality standards while providing downloadable documentation of findings.
Turnitin Checker
Turnitin Checker provides a comprehensive online platform designed to help users ensure the originality and quality of written content. With seamless integration of plagiarism detection, AI content analysis, and intelligent proofreading, this tool makes verifying academic, professional, and marketing documents both accessible and accurate. Leveraging a vast global comparison database, the platform checks your text against billions of internet sources, books, and theses with detailed, easy-to-understand reports.
From confidential file handling to rapid, automated results, Turnitin Checker is suitable for students, teachers, writers, and SEO marketers looking to improve their documents. Its user-friendly interface allows anyone to quickly upload documents, choose the required checks, and receive comprehensive feedback — all at some of the most competitive rates available, ensuring reliability without compromising privacy or efficiency.
